Impinj RFID Solution Ensures Food Freshness and Consumer Safety
Published: June 6, 2008
Impinj delivered a UHF RFID-based system to METRO Group, in the most comprehensive in-store quality assurance initiative to date.

UHF Gen 2 radio-frequency identification (RFID) solutions provider Impinj, Inc. recently announced a groundbreaking implementation in food freshness and customer safety. Impinj delivered a UHF RFID-based system to the world’s third largest retailer, METRO Group, in the most comprehensive in-store quality assurance initiative to date. At the launch of their Future Store, METRO Group began using RFID in the butchery to guarantee freshness, increase customer safety and efficiently manage inventory.

METRO Group adds an Impinj Monza powered tag to each meat package before placing it in a customer-facing Smart Freezer. Approximately 50 Impinj Speedway readers and 200 Impinj near-field UHF antennas inside the Smart Freezer continually monitor the "best before" date for each package and alert store personnel to remove goods before they reach that date. Additional read points at both point-of-sale terminals and exit gates make sure that stock levels are accurately monitored at all times. As a key element in METRO Group’s goal of ensuring that customers purchase only fresh meat products, Impinj’s technology provides real-time, automated inventory, eliminating a tedious and error-prone daily manual inventory.

"Impinj’s position as a leader in the RFID business and their experience with item-level tagging made them the natural choice for our implementation. We have worked with them in the past and have been satisfied with the results each time," said Dr. Gerd Wolfram, Managing Director of METRO Group Information Technology. "We use RFID in our real, – Future Store in Toenisvorst in order to ensure the quality assurance and inventory of fresh self-service meat products. We believe it is our responsibility to provide customers with the highest level of safety possible, and working with Impinj RFID technology gives us maximum levels of performance with minimal integration issues."
